BSDCan 2008, held in May, in Ottowa, has the initial call for papers out. They have space for informal talks and presentations too.
BSDCan is an enormously successful grass-roots style conference. It brings together a great mix of *BSD developers and users for a nice blend of both developer-centric and user-centric presentations, food, and activities.
BSDCan 2008 will be held 16-17 May 2008, in Ottawa.
The organisers are now requesting proposals for papers. The papers should be written with a very strong technical content bias.
